One-Bedroom Apartment
Featuring a private entrance, this apartment also consists of 1 bedroom, a seating area and 1 bathroom with a shower and a hairdryer. Guests can make meals in the kitchenette that is equipped with a stovetop, a refrigerator, kitchenware and a microwave. This apartment features a washing machine, a tea and coffee maker, a flat-screen TV with streaming services and a patio. The unit offers 2 beds.
Max Occupancy: 4 (4 Adults)

- Edward (6/5): - The kitchen was well equipped and the coffee (Keurig) was great. The BBQ, used once, was good but inconvenient to access due to the basement apartment.
The bed was large and very comfortable. The towels were first class. The area and street was very quiet and walkable. The lighting was harsh, horrible fluorescent fixtures in all rooms except the shower/ washroom. The washroom was small but the worst thing was the tiny shower in a dark corner. All the window sills were quite dirty, and so were the windows. Floors appeared clean but in fact we're not. The TV was highly complicated and frustrating to use.
The exterior aluminum entry door was a piece of junk and really gives a bad first impression. Several times there were bugs crawling on the inside and on exterior of that door, rather creepy.
